📚 Understanding Hearing vs. Understanding Vocabulary in Grade 1

Hearing and understanding vocabulary are two distinct skills, especially important for first graders learning to communicate effectively. Hearing refers to the ability to perceive sounds, while understanding vocabulary involves comprehending the meaning of words. Let's delve into the differences.

🔎 Defining Hearing

Hearing is the physical process of sound waves entering the ear and being transmitted to the brain.

  • 👂Physical Reception: The ear detects sound waves.
  • 🧠Neural Transmission: Signals are sent to the brain.
  • 🔊Passive Process: Requires no active thought or interpretation.

📖 Defining Understanding Vocabulary

Understanding vocabulary is the ability to comprehend the meaning of words, phrases, and sentences. It involves connecting words with their definitions and using them appropriately.

  • 🧠Cognitive Process: Requires active thought and interpretation.
  • 📚Meaning Association: Linking words to their definitions and concepts.
  • 🗣️Contextual Usage: Knowing how to use words correctly in different situations.

📝 Hearing vs. Understanding Vocabulary: A Comparison

Feature Hearing Understanding Vocabulary
Process Physical Cognitive
Involvement Passive Active
Outcome Sound Detection Meaning Comprehension
Key Skills Auditory Perception Semantic Knowledge, Contextual Awareness
Assessment Audiometry Tests Vocabulary Tests, Reading Comprehension Exercises

💡 Key Takeaways

  • 🔑Essential Foundation: Hearing is a prerequisite for understanding vocabulary.
  • 🌱Developmental Stages: Vocabulary understanding grows with exposure and learning.
  • 🍎Educational Focus: Teaching strategies should promote both auditory and cognitive development.
  • 🗣️Communication Skills: Vocabulary understanding is crucial for effective communication.
  • 🧩Interconnected Skills: While distinct, hearing and understanding vocabulary work together for effective language processing.
